>On Wed, Jan 08, 2020 at 12:37:18PM +0100, Pawel Laszczak wrote:
>> The ARM core hang when access USB register after tens of thousands
>> connect/disconnect operation.
>>
>> The issue was observed on platform with android system and is not easy
>> to reproduce. During test controller works at HS device mode with host
>> connected.
>>
>> The test is based on continuous disabling/enabling USB device function
>> what cause continuous setting DEVDS/DEVEN bit in USB_CONF register.
>>
>> For testing was used composite device consisting from ADP and RNDIS
>> function.
>>
>> Presumably the problem was caused by DMA transfer made after setting
>> DEVDS bit. To resolve this issue fix stops all DMA transfer before
>> setting DEVDS bit.
